Forefather came out of the Canadian underground in the early 1990s. The band was led by vocalist Matt Vera, with guitarist Dean Chalmers, bassist Rick Prosser, and drummer Shane McEntee forming a consistent lineup through various challenges.
Their debut album was called "Inner Urge to Kill." They followed it with releases like "Curse of the Damned" and "Destroyer." Songs like "Ancient Voice" and "Curse Of The Cwelled" show the aggressive style they became known for.
They faced label disputes and financial hardship early on, but kept working. The track "Iron Hand" became something of an anthem for their uncompromising approach.
